Cytogenetic Study in Females with Secondary Infertility

Journal Title: Journal of Medical Science And clinical Research - Year 2016, Vol 4, Issue 8

Abstract

Infertility affects approximately 10%-15% of couples in reproductive age. There is a complex correlation between genetics and infertility. Several factors affect on gametogenesis, from which factors that lead to chromosomal abnormalities are one of the best known. The aim of this study was to determine type and rate of chromosomal abnormalities in females suffering from secondary infertility [1]. We studied 67 females with history of secondary infertility to find out the proportion of cytogenetic causes in them. We observed chromosomal abnormalities in 2.98% females, of which showed structural abnormalities.
